A George IV Vinaigrette made in Birmingham in 1823 by John Bettridge.

The Vinaigrette is broad rectanguar in form and is engraved on the cover with trellis work designs and stylised foliate motifs around a rectangular cartouche engraved with contemporary script initials. The base is engraved with a foliate spray and prick dot bands. The interior is finely gilded and the grille is pierced and engraved with pluming scrolls.
Length: 1.45 inches, 3.63cm.
Width: 0.9 inches, 2.25cm.
